[发明专利]一种基于协同进化的多回收站点垃圾收运方法有效
申请号: | 201910778661.X | 申请日: | 2019-08-22 |
公开(公告)号: | CN110516870B | 公开(公告)日: | 2023-09-22 |
发明(设计)人: | 张玉州;张子为 | 申请(专利权)人: | 安庆师范大学 |
主分类号: | G06Q10/047 | 分类号: | G06Q10/047;G06Q50/26;G06F18/23;G06N3/126 |
代理公司: | 温州市品创专利商标代理事务所(普通合伙) 33247 | 代理人: | 洪中清 |
地址: | 246000 *** | 国省代码: | 安徽;34 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 协同 进化 回收 站点 垃圾 方法 | ||
本发明提供一种基于协同进化的多回收站点垃圾收运方法,使用CC‑HGA改进聚类算法,将各垃圾收集点分配至合适的回收站点,从而将MSRCP转换成若干单回收点的垃圾收运问题;具体包括8个步骤实现对多回收站点垃圾收运。本发明的有益效果是:改进聚类算法结合CC框架对解空间进行分解,提供更好的分组,子群体的进化协作引导整个种群的进化,有效加快算法的效率,提高算法解决高维问题的能力;混合遗传算法改进了局部搜索算子,扩大了解的搜索范围,克服了算法解决问题时遇到的早收敛问题。
技术领域
本发明属于垃圾集运方法领域,尤其是涉及一种基于协同进化的多回收站点垃圾收运方法。
背景技术
生活垃圾的产生与城市经济发展水平、城市人口、居民收入、消费结构等息息相关。人们在创造经济产出的同时,也在产生垃圾,我国城市生活垃圾清运量年均复合增长率约为2.11%,在垃圾处理成本中,垃圾收运费用占有相当大的比例。交通基础设施建设不断完善、环卫机械化率的提高以及政府对垃圾收运工作的重视,众多因素推动着垃圾收集和转运行业已经成为富有广阔发展前景的新兴产业,在这一背景下开展垃圾收运路线的优化研究、降低垃圾收运成本具有重要的现实意义。
目前,垃圾收运问题(Refuse Collection Problem,RCP)的研究集中于基本的单回收站垃圾收运问题,而后者可映射为基本的车辆路径问题(Vehicle Routing Problem,VRP)。因此,学者以VRP的研究成果为基础,对单回收站垃圾收运问题展开了一系列的探索。吕新福等人对中转站的位置、数目不确定的情况,提出建立新模型,采用启发式算法求解。Kim等人对实际生活中垃圾收运问题,考虑路径紧凑性和工作负载平衡两个现实因素,提出基于容量聚类的垃圾收集算法求解。Benjamin等人考虑大规模的垃圾收运情况,先后提出变量邻域搜索的元启发式算法和能选择最佳的垃圾回收站以进入车辆路线的(DisposalFacility Positioning,DFP)算法求解。Akhtar等人研究有容量约束的垃圾收运问题,采用一种改进的回溯搜索算法(Backtracking Search Algorithm,BSA)求解。路玉龙等人对这类问题也实现了不同的求解算法,如遗传算法、变邻域搜索算法和蚁群算法。
上述研究建立在基本VRP的应用背景下,对单回收站的垃圾收运问题进行了建模,并提出相关问题的求解算法。近年来,由于城镇规模的不断扩大以及垃圾量的剧增,设置多个回收站进行垃圾收运是解决该问题的常规措施。显然,多回收站垃圾收运问题(Multi-sation Refuse Collection Problem,MSRCP)较传统的单回收站问题复杂,其难点在于回收区域的划分和回收点的归属问题。多回收站垃圾收运问题可映射为多中心车辆路径问题(Multi-depot Vehicle Routing Problem,MDVRP),MDVRP为基本VRP的扩展。较VRP,MDVRP的研究非常有限,对回收区域合理划分方面研究相对稀缺,算法类型单一,张军等人采用扫描算法与最优划分过程产生待选解集,再利用启发式算法改进解。彭北青等人采用基于基地启发式分区算法对区域进行划分。于滨等人采用基于聚集度的启发式分类算法和蚁群算法求解。Luo等人采用K-Means算法执行聚类分析。
面对复杂问题,分而治之(Divide and Conquer,DC)是解决问题的有效途径之一,协同进化(Cooperative Co-evolutionary,CC)则是DC的典型代表策略,最早由Potter提出。CC结合演化思想,以明确的模块化概念为基础,以交互的形式进化,为解决复杂的结构提供合理的解决方案,其求解问题主要分为三步:问题分解、子问题求解、子问题合并。结合遗传算法提出的,引入CC与具体演化算法结合解决了一系列的复杂问题。由于MDVRP具有明显的问题划分特征,Oliveira等以CC为框架,以各驻车点为中心,首先进行任务聚类、划分,然后使用并行程序设计方案对其进行了求解。
显然,对于MSRCP而言,存在两个重要的基本问题:(1)垃圾收集点的归属、划分;(2)每个回收站点的车辆路径规划。如何解决上述存在问题,成为了关键。
发明内容
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于安庆师范大学,未经安庆师范大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910778661.X/2.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类
G06Q 专门适用于行政、商业、金融、管理、监督或预测目的的数据处理系统或方法;其他类目不包含的专门适用于行政、商业、金融、管理、监督或预测目的的处理系统或方法
G06Q10-00 行政;管理
G06Q10-02 .预定,例如用于门票、服务或事件的
G06Q10-04 .预测或优化,例如线性规划、“旅行商问题”或“下料问题”
G06Q10-06 .资源、工作流、人员或项目管理,例如组织、规划、调度或分配时间、人员或机器资源;企业规划;组织模型
G06Q10-08 .物流,例如仓储、装货、配送或运输;存货或库存管理,例如订货、采购或平衡订单
G06Q10-10 .办公自动化,例如电子邮件或群件的计算机辅助管理